Understanding Pan Mechanism

The pan mechanism in tripod heads allows horizontal rotation, enabling the user to smoothly pan the camera from side to side. This feature is vital for capturing wide panoramic shots or tracking moving subjects horizontally with precision. The pan mechanism typically consists of a rotating base that facilitates this horizontal movement.

When adjusting the pan mechanism, users can control the rotational movement of the tripod head along the horizontal axis. By loosening or tightening the pan lock, photographers can either allow for smooth, continuous panning or lock the camera in a fixed position. This level of control is essential for achieving stable and well-framed shots in various shooting scenarios.

A high-quality pan mechanism ensures fluid motion and stability during panning movements, contributing to the overall performance of the tripod head. The design and construction of the pan mechanism directly impact the user’s experience, with factors such as the material used, gear ratios, and locking mechanisms influencing the smoothness and precision of horizontal rotations. Delving into Locking Mechanisms

Locking mechanisms play a critical role in tripod heads, ensuring stability and security during operations. These mechanisms are designed to hold the position of the tripod head firmly in place to prevent any unwanted movement or slippage. Different types of locking mechanisms are utilized in tripod heads, each serving specific functions to enhance performance and precision.

Key aspects of locking mechanisms include:

  • Friction Locks: Utilize friction to secure the position of the tripod head. Adjusting the tension controls the level of resistance and stability.
  • Lever Locks: Operated by flipping a lever to lock or release the position. Quick and easy to adjust, providing fast setup in dynamic situations.
  • Twist Locks: Require twisting a knob or collar to lock or unlock the position. Offers a secure hold and precise adjustments for various shooting angles.

Reliability of Various Construction Materials

When it comes to tripod head mechanisms within military contexts, the reliability of various construction materials plays a pivotal role in ensuring operational success and longevity of equipment. Understanding the strengths and weaknesses of different materials is essential for military applications. Here are key considerations:

  1. Aluminum: Widely used for its balance of strength and weight, aluminum offers durability and corrosion resistance while remaining lightweight for portability.
  2. Carbon Fiber: Known for its high strength-to-weight ratio, carbon fiber provides exceptional durability and rigidity, making it ideal for demanding military environments.
  3. Stainless Steel: prized for its robustness and resistance to harsh conditions, stainless steel ensures longevity and reliability even in extreme combat situations.
  4. Magnesium Alloy: favored for its lightweight yet sturdy properties, magnesium alloy provides a good compromise between weight reduction and strength for military applications.

Cleaning Procedures for Longevity

Proper cleaning procedures are essential for maintaining the longevity and optimal performance of tripod head mechanisms, especially in military settings where equipment durability is crucial. Begin by using a soft, lint-free cloth to gently wipe down the external surfaces of the tripod head, removing any dust, dirt, or grime that may have accumulated during use in challenging environments. Avoid harsh chemicals or solvents that could damage the materials and components of the mechanism.

For more thorough cleaning, lightly dampen a cloth with a mild, non-abrasive cleaning solution and carefully wipe down all moving parts of the tripod head, paying close attention to areas where grit or debris may have entered. Take care not to oversaturate the cloth to prevent excess moisture from seeping into sensitive areas of the mechanism. After cleaning, ensure that the tripod head is completely dry before storage or further use.

Periodically inspect the tripod head for any signs of wear, corrosion, or damage that may affect its functionality. If any issues are identified, address them promptly to prevent further deterioration. Additionally, storing the tripod head in a clean, dry environment when not in use can help prolong its lifespan and prevent unnecessary wear and tear.
